Hi! Here are my notes:

The sentence "In his first contributions, Percy proved his knowledge and interest in the good and bad that accompanies contemporary culture." needs to be attributed along the lines of "According to scholars such as X, Percy proved his knowledge and interest in the good and bad that accompanies contemporary culture with his first contributions." The reason is that this could be seen as a bit of an opinion statement. The same thing goes for "He presents a new way of viewing the struggles of the common man through his specific use of anecdotes and language", since it just needs to be attributed. The same needs to be done for the influence section. The writing isn't bad or anything, it just needs to be attributed.
